Nvidia Unveils Historic $500 Billion U.S. AI Supercomputer Initiative

 

Nvidia Unveils Historic $500 Billion Plan to Manufacture AI Supercomputers in the US

Tech Giant Partners with TSMC, Foxconn to Create American-Made AI Infrastructure in Game-Changing Domestic Production Shift

Nvidia has announced an ambitious plan to manufacture AI supercomputers entirely in the United States for the first time, committing to produce up to $500 billion worth of AI infrastructure over the next four years. This landmark initiative includes partnerships with manufacturing giants like TSMC, Foxconn, and Wistron to build facilities in Texas and Arizona, signaling a major shift in high-tech manufacturing toward domestic production.



AI Manufacturing Comes Home: The Core Development

Nvidia's groundbreaking decision marks a significant departure from its traditional reliance on overseas manufacturing. The company has commissioned over one million square feet of manufacturing space to build and test its advanced Blackwell AI chips in Arizona and construct complete AI supercomputers in Texas NVIDIA Blog1.

"The engines of the world's AI infrastructure are being built in the United States for the first time," said Jensen Huang, founder and CEO of Nvidia. "Adding American manufacturing helps us better meet the incredible and growing demand for AI chips and supercomputers, strengthens our supply chain and boosts our resiliency" Reuters2.

The initiative involves several key manufacturing partnerships:

  • TSMC has already begun production of Nvidia's Blackwell chips at its Phoenix, Arizona plants
  • Foxconn will operate a supercomputer manufacturing plant in Houston, Texas
  • Wistron is establishing a facility in Dallas, Texas
  • Amkor and SPIL will handle packaging and testing operations in Arizona

Mass production at these facilities is expected to ramp up within the next 12-15 months, with the ambitious goal of producing half a trillion dollars of AI infrastructure in the United States within four years NVIDIA Blog1.

Industry and Political Reactions

Nvidia's announcement aligns with a broader trend among tech companies responding to the current administration's "America-first" approach to technology and manufacturing. This strategic pivot comes amid growing concerns about international trade tensions and supply chain vulnerabilities.

The move follows similar commitments from other tech giants:

  • OpenAI recently partnered with SoftBank and Oracle for a $500 billion U.S. data center initiative called the Stargate Project
  • Microsoft has pledged $80 billion to build AI data centers in its 2025 fiscal year, with 50% allocated for U.S. facilities
  • Apple has promised half a trillion dollars in U.S. investments over the next four years, including a factory in Texas for artificial intelligence servers TechCrunch3

The timing of Nvidia's announcement appears strategic, coming after recent statements from President Donald Trump threatening steep tariffs on companies that continue to manufacture overseas. In April, Trump reportedly warned TSMC that it would face a 100% tax if it didn't build facilities in the U.S. TechCrunch3.

Expert Analysis: Opportunities and Challenges

Industry analysts view Nvidia's move as both opportunistic and necessary in the current geopolitical climate. The company claims this initiative will create "hundreds of thousands" of jobs and generate "trillions of dollars" in economic activity over the coming decades TechCrunch3.

However, the path to domestic manufacturing excellence faces significant obstacles:

"Retaliatory tariffs and trade restrictions from China threaten the supply of necessary raw materials to build chips in the U.S., and there's a severe shortage of skilled frontline workers to assemble chips," notes TechCrunch in its analysis of the announcement TechCrunch3.

The company's technological approach to these challenges is noteworthy. Nvidia plans to utilize its advanced AI, robotics, and digital twin technologies to design and operate the facilities efficiently. This includes using NVIDIA Omniverse to create digital twins of factories and NVIDIA Isaac GR00T to build robots for automating manufacturing processes NVIDIA Blog1.

Future Implications: Reshaping the AI Landscape

Nvidia's investment signals a fundamental shift in how AI infrastructure is developed and deployed. These AI supercomputers are described as "the engines of a new type of data center created for the sole purpose of processing artificial intelligence" NVIDIA Blog1.

The long-term implications of this move include:

  1. Supply Chain Transformation: By manufacturing in the U.S., Nvidia aims to reduce dependence on international supply chains that have proven vulnerable to disruptions from pandemics, geopolitical tensions, and natural disasters.

  2. Employment Opportunities: The initiative promises to create hundreds of thousands of jobs, potentially revitalizing American manufacturing while addressing the shortage of skilled workers in semiconductor production.

  3. Competitive Positioning: As the AI race intensifies globally, domestic production could give Nvidia a strategic advantage in securing government contracts and strengthening relationships with U.S.-based tech companies.

  4. Policy Influence: This massive investment may influence future government policies regarding semiconductor manufacturing, potentially leading to additional incentives for domestic production.

However, uncertainty remains regarding the Trump administration's approach to the CHIPS Act, a bill passed in 2022 to provide billions in grants to chipmakers. Any moves to undermine this legislation could impact future investments in the semiconductor industry TechCrunch3.
